"Xbox Japanese Price Drop
Now it's cheaper than it is in America.
November 07, 2003 - Microsoft Japan confirmed today that the Xbox will be receiving a price drop in Japan. Starting 11/11, the normal system which comes with a controller and the DVD playback kit will be priced at 16800 yen (approximately $152). That's far lower than the current $200+ American price for the similar bundle.
But that's not all! On 11/20, Microsoft will release a limited edition Xbox bundle so good we may just have to buy a second system (although god knows where we'd put it!). On that day, the same day as the release of Project Gotham Racing 2, MS will release a 19800 yen "Platina Box" which comes packed with the Xbox hardware, two controllers (one gray, one black), the DVD playback kit, a copy of Project Gotham Racing 2, Halo and two months free Xbox Live Service. All that for the equivalent of $180. Wowzers!"
